Job Summary
The Psychiatric Rehabilitation Worker is responsible for leading and facilitating groups of the Westmoreland Psychiatric Rehabilitation program. This position provides individualized teaching, training, and support to adults with severe and persistent mental illnesses. Responsibilities include completing and updating assessments of needs and strengths required by the program, developing and leading groups, providing vocational and independent life skills training. The Psychiatric Rehabilitation Worker provides skill/resource development, counseling and encouragement to clients as they move into vocational or community based activities of their choice; ensures that all clients receive the level of and/or have access to the services/supports they choose, and to monitor and track client progress of assigned caseload; and participates in the development of individualized rehabilitation plans. This job helps provides a safe and therapeutic environment and facilitating a client-centered focus on recovery. Psychiatric Rehabilitation workers provide services which are developed to assist individuals in reaching their optimal level of community integration.
